Transaction fc59ea4632a258be8618121860af4e6afe7a80aeabfcca881bc5b73b79304699

1 Input
2 Outputs
  • fc59ea4632a258be8618121860af4e6afe7a80aeabfcca881bc5b73b79304699:0
  • value  858572
    address  33bQuKTXticNwDx6snggRCGHKwFtMriBmF
  • fc59ea4632a258be8618121860af4e6afe7a80aeabfcca881bc5b73b79304699:1
  • value  5197108
    address  3B944CGmH2rjiLNufPYaGXLP3pE2TfehgN